@import url('https://fonts.googleapis.com/css2?family=Montserrat:ital,wght@0,100;0,200;0,300;0,400;0,500;0,600;0,700;0,800;0,900;1,100;1,200;1,300;1,400;1,500;1,600;1,700;1,800;1,900&display=swap');
*{ font-family:Montserrat;}

.custom-app-tabs .sf-button .btn-bg {font-size: 8px;}

*{ font-family:Montserrat;}

.custom-app-tabs .border-l svg {width: 24px!important;}

/*--BURBUJA PUSH EN MICUENTA--*/
#ul-menu-id36515 {width: 0px;}
#menu-id36515 .border-l, #menu-id36515 .btn-bg {display: none!important;}
.burbuja-push {left: 55px!important;}

/*---burbuja promos---*/
.burbuja-promos {
    /*display: block!important;*/
    background-color: #b32301;
    box-shadow: 0 0 0 1px #FFF;
    color: #fff;
    font-size: 9px;
    height: 12px;
    left: 50%;
    margin-left: 2px;
    padding: 1px 4px;
    min-width: 6px;
    position: absolute;
    top: 3px;
    -webkit-border-radius: 8px;
    -moz-border-radius: 8px;
    border-radius: 8px;
}


/*--FLECHA ATRAS--*/
.fa-angle-left:before {font-weight: 900; font-size: 28px;}


/*-- home .pagina-5375 --*/
/*------------------------------------------------------------------*/
/*--- ++++++ EN LISTADO + IMAGENES SUBMENU  y LOGOS CARROUSEL OK ---*/
/*------------------------------------------------------------------*/

.pagina-5375 #accordion:not(.submenu-in-home-carousel) .row-centered .list-reducido:last-child .media-size { width: 20px!important; }
.pagina-5375 #accordion:not(.submenu-in-home-carousel) .row-centered .list-reducido:last-child .media-size img { height: 32px!important; }

.pagina-5375 #accordion:not(.submenu-in-home-carousel) .row-centered .list-reducido :last-child .media-size {width: 20px!important;}
.pagina-5375 #accordion:not(.submenu-in-home-carousel) .row-centered .list-reducido .media-size :LAST-CHILD img   {height: 32px!important;}

/*------------------*/
/*-listado reducido-*/
/*------------------*/
.list-reducido.col-centered  { padding-left: 3rem; padding-right: 2.5rem; }
.submenu-in-home .submenu-home-items .list-title { font-size: 15px; }
.submenu-in-home a:hover { color:red; font-weight:600!important; }

/*----------------------------*/
/*- familia listado reducido -*/
/*----------------------------*/
.familia.btn.btn-link.link-collapse.collapsed {color: black!important;}
.familia.btn.btn-link.link-collapse {color: red!important;}
.submenu-in-home .page-header h2 button {font-weight: 600;font-size: 16px ;}
.title-center .page-header h2 { padding: 1rem .2rem!important;}

/*------------------------*/
/*- carrousel CUSTOM -2  -*/
/*------------------------*/

.scroll-horizontal .lazyloaded {
    max-width: 70px!important;
    max-height: 70px;
    height: 70px;
    border-radius: 100px!important;
}

.card-title {
    color: black!important;
    font-family: 'Montserrat', sans-serif;
    font-size: 10px;
    font-weight:300;
    margin-bottom: 15px!important;
    text-transform: Capitalize;
    margin: 0 3rem;
}

.col-phone-horizontal.col-desk-horizontal.col-centered { width: 110px; }
#anchor-39992 { margin-bottom: 0rem;    margin-top: 3rem;     margin-left: 0px!important; }
.carrousel-inteligente>div {margin-right: 0px!important; }

/*--------------------------------------------------------------*/
/*------ pagina BUSCADOR pagina-5389 + buscador boton tab ------*/
/*--------------------------------------------------------------*/


/*-buscador-*/
.pagina-5389 .btn-primary {background-color: #e9e9e9!important; border-color: transparent!important; color: #555555!important;}
.pagina-5389 .form-control {border:none!important; background-color: #e9e9e9!important; height: 45px!important;}
.pagina-5389 .fa-search:before {content: "\f002";font-size: 18px;}
.pagina-5389 #form-search-carta .buscador-ecommerce {height: 45px;}
.pagina-5389 .input-group.buscador-ecommerce.col-xs-12.col-sm-8.col-md-8.col-lg-4 {padding:0px!important;}

/*-----  principal  -----*/
.pagina-5375 #anchor-45932 .card-title { display:none; }

/*--PAGINA BUSCADOR V2.0   .pagina-5367 #106086 --*/

.pagina-5389 #id106106 .col-xs-12 {display: none!important;}
.pagina-5389 #id106106 .fa {display: none!important;}
.pagina-5389 #id106106 .list-reducido .media-content {padding: .2rem 3rem!important;}
.pagina-5389 #id106106 .list-reducido .list-title { font-weight: 400!important;}
.pagina-5389 #id106106 .card-home .card-description {text-align: left; margin-left: 2rem; font-weight: 600; font-size: 1.6rem;}
.pagina-5389 #anchor-46024.wrapper-section { padding: 7rem 5rem 0rem 5rem!important;}
.pagina-5389 #anchor-46027.wrapper-section {padding: 1rem 0!important;}